TICKET #: Vault locked after DNS flakiness

Hey support folks — the Coffer vault at Brindlemere keeps locking itself because name resolution to the unseal endpoint times out intermittently. Looks like the resolver on the Pellwick cluster returns stale answers about one in ten lookups, the vault client gives up, and then it seals as a precaution. Workaround until networking fixes the resolver: manually unseal after each flake. When prompted, use the recovery passphrase below.

recovery phrase for fajep-yaweg: gilath-sorox-wenius-rusdor-keliel-zorius

## Canary Gating — quick notes

Hey, welcome aboard! Quick rundown on how Driftgate decides whether a canary for the Plumeline service gets promoted. We watch error rate, p99 latency, and saturation for 20 minutes; any metric breaching twice in a row auto-rolls back. Manual overrides go through the Harborfell dashboard, and yes, they get logged. To poke the gating API from your laptop, you'll need auth. Paste the request header with the token below.

portal login ticket: eyJhbGciOiJIUzI1NiIsInR5cCI6IkpXVCJ9.eyJzdWIiOiI0Z4ywpUMsBIn0.ca5FVhkdBXa3

## 5.2.3 — Key rotation

Rotated release signing key alongside the GraphQL N+1 fix in the Fernhawk resolver layer. Batch loading cut query volume ~90% on the orders endpoint. Old key revoked; verification against it fails after tonight. If pager fires on signature errors, confirm agents pulled the new bundle. Current signing key below.

deploy key for kaduf-bagep: bky6_NNeq4d

## Environments — Brindlehop Auth Service

Heads up, support folks: the session-token refresh bug only shows up in **staging** and **prod-eu**, because those environments run the shorter refresh window. If a customer reports being logged out mid-session, check which environment their tenant is pinned to before escalating. Sandbox is unaffected, so don't bother reproducing there. For reference, the affected environments currently run with these configuration values:

service settings:
[silwyn]
host = silwyn.crelvogrid.internal
user = silwyn_svc
database = silwyn_prod